With more than 34400 students, and approximately 1700 members of staff, the Durban University of Technology (DUT) is a leading university of technology proudly located in the beautiful cities of Durban and Pietermaritzburg, along the warm east coast of South Africa. Founded in April 2002 through the historic merger of the former ML Sultan Technikon and Technikon Natal, DUT has evolved into a modern, metropolitan, multi-campus university with roots tracing back to 1907.
Today, DUT is recognised nationally and internationally for its excellence in teaching and learning, research, innovation, entrepreneurship and engagement. A proud member of the International Association of Universities, DUT continues to expand its influence across South Africa and the world. In the 2025 Webometrics Rankings, DUT was ranked among the Top 6% of all universities and colleges worldwide, reflecting its academic excellence, research impact and strong global visibility.

Purpose of the Role
To develop, maintain, manage and execute a comprehensive process for identifying, assessing, mitigating, monitoring and reporting on risks that may impact the University’s mandate and strategy.

Key Responsibilities
The successful candidate will be responsible for:
+ Develop and update ERM policies, frameworks and procedures.
+ Coordinate the Risk Champions Forum.
+ Promote a risk-aware organisational culture.
+ Facilitate risk identification across strategic, operational and project levels.
+ Develop and maintain risk registers.
+ Conduct environmental scanning and prepare risk workshop materials.
+ Provide expert risk advice across the institution.
+ Track emerging risks and align them to institutional strategy.
+ Develop reports including dashboards, KRIs, and risk appetite indicators.
+ Develop and facilitate ERM training programmes.
+ Support awareness initiatives across staff and students.
+ Provide coaching and mentoring on ERM practices.
+ Compile quarterly risk reports and combined assurance reports.
+ Monitor mitigation actions and audit recommendations.
+ Support data-driven decision-making processes.
